编程原本写的是什么东西
-
编程原本指的是将人类的思维逻辑转化为计算机能够理解和执行的指令集合。它是一种创造性的过程,通过编写代码,开发者可以实现各种功能和应用,从简单的计算器到复杂的操作系统、应用程序和网站等。编程是计算机科学的核心领域之一,也是现代社会中不可或缺的技能。
在编程的早期,人们使用机器语言编写程序,这是一种由0和1组成的二进制代码。然而,这种编程方式复杂而繁琐,需要精确的指令和极高的细致度。为了简化编程的过程,人们开始开发高级编程语言,如Fortran、C、C++、Java和Python等。这些语言提供了更加人性化和易于理解的语法,使得编程变得更加简单和高效。
编程的本质是将问题分解为更小的、可处理的部分,并为每个部分编写相应的代码。这种分解和抽象的能力是编程师的核心能力之一。通过使用不同的编程技术和算法,程序员可以解决各种复杂的问题,并开发出高效、可靠的软件。
随着科技的进步和计算机技术的发展,编程的应用范围也越来越广泛。从科学研究到商业应用,从娱乐产业到社交媒体,几乎所有领域都需要编程的支持。通过编程,人们可以实现自己的创意和想法,并推动社会的进步和发展。
总之,编程原本是一种将人类思维转化为计算机指令的过程。它是计算机科学的核心领域之一,也是现代社会中不可或缺的技能。通过编程,人们可以解决各种问题,并创造出各种功能和应用。编程的应用范围广泛,对于个人和社会的发展都具有重要意义。
1年前 -
编程是一种创造性的过程,通过编写一系列指令来告诉计算机如何执行特定任务。编程可以用来创建各种不同类型的软件和应用程序,例如操作系统、网站、游戏和移动应用程序。在编程过程中,开发者使用特定的编程语言来编写代码,并通过编译或解释器将其转换成计算机可以理解和执行的指令。
以下是编程原本的五个要点:
-
逻辑思考能力:编程要求开发者具备良好的逻辑思考能力。开发者需要能够分析问题,设计解决方案,并将其转化为可执行的代码。逻辑思考能力是编程中最重要的技能之一。
-
语言和工具:编程需要使用特定的编程语言和开发工具。不同的编程语言适用于不同的应用场景和目标。例如,Python适用于数据科学和机器学习,JavaScript适用于网页开发,C++适用于系统级编程等。开发者需要学习并熟练掌握适合自己需求的编程语言和工具。
-
算法和数据结构:算法和数据结构是编程的基础。开发者需要学习和理解不同的算法和数据结构,以便能够选择合适的方法来解决问题。熟练掌握算法和数据结构可以提高程序的效率和性能。
-
调试和故障排除:在编程过程中,经常会遇到错误和bug。开发者需要具备调试和故障排除的能力,以便能够找到并修复问题。调试工具和技巧对于解决编程中的问题非常重要。
-
持续学习和提升:编程是一个不断学习和提升的过程。技术发展迅速,新的编程语言和工具不断涌现。开发者需要保持学习的状态,跟进最新的技术和趋势,以便能够不断提高自己的编程能力。
总之,编程是一种创造性的过程,需要开发者具备逻辑思考能力、掌握特定的编程语言和工具、理解算法和数据结构、具备调试和故障排除的能力,并持续学习和提升自己的技能。编程的应用广泛,对于解决问题和创造新的技术具有重要作用。
1年前 -
-
编程原本指的是使用计算机语言编写代码,实现特定功能的过程。编程可以用于开发各种软件应用程序、网站、游戏等。编程的本质是将问题分解为一系列的步骤或指令,并用计算机语言将这些指令编写成代码,让计算机能够理解并执行。
编程的过程可以分为以下几个步骤:
-
确定问题:首先要明确需要解决的问题或实现的功能。这个问题可以是一个具体的需求,也可以是一个抽象的概念。
-
设计算法:在确定问题后,需要设计一个算法来解决问题。算法是一系列的步骤或指令,描述了解决问题的方法和过程。
-
选择编程语言:根据问题的特点和需求,选择合适的编程语言来实现算法。不同的编程语言有不同的特点和适用范围,选择合适的编程语言可以提高开发效率和代码质量。
-
编写代码:根据算法和选择的编程语言,编写代码来实现功能。代码是由一系列的语句组成,每个语句都是一条指令,告诉计算机应该执行什么操作。
-
调试和测试:编写完代码后,需要进行调试和测试。调试是指通过排查错误和问题,修复代码中的错误。测试是指验证代码是否按照预期工作,是否满足需求。
-
优化和改进:在代码调试和测试完成后,可以对代码进行优化和改进,以提高性能、减少资源消耗或增加功能。
-
部署和发布:当代码完成并通过测试后,可以将其部署到实际环境中使用。这可能涉及将代码上传到服务器、打包成可执行文件、发布到应用商店等步骤。
编程的操作流程可以根据不同的开发方法和工具而有所差异,但以上步骤是一个通用的框架。在实际开发中,还需要不断学习和掌握新的编程技术和工具,以适应不断变化的需求和技术发展。
1年前 -